About Wensong Wang

Wensong Wang is a scholar working on Civil and Structural Engineering, General Engineering and Management, Monitoring, Policy and Law, having authored 56 papers that have together received 1.4k ind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include Tailings Management and Properties (18 papers), Rock Mechanics and Modeling (12 papers) and Landslides and related hazards (10 papers). The work is most often cited by research in Electronic, Optical and Magnetic Materials (466 citations), Civil and Structural Engineering (505 citations) and Mechanics of Materials (362 citations). Wensong Wang has collaborated with scholars based in China, Australia and United Kingdom. Frequent co-authors include Lingyun Chen, Biao Huang, Chenglan Zhao, Jie Li, Tao Pu, Li Xie, Zuoan Wei, Jikui Zhu, Guangzhi Yin and Yonghao Yang. Their work appears in journals such as Chemical Engineering Journal, Journal of Colloid and Interface Science and Construction and Building Materials.
